Hong Kong’s leading personal care retailer, Watsons, has rolled out a limited-time promotional campaign offering customers purchasing selected Colgate toothpaste products a substantial collection of complimentary household and kitchen items valued at over HK$902. Running from now until February 17th, this initiative aims to reward consumers with high-value gifts upon meeting minimum purchase requirements, encompassing everything from three-piece cookware sets to branded sanitizing agents and staple beverages, available both in physical stores and via the Watsons online platform while stocks last.

Beyond Oral Cleaning: A Strategic Value Proposition
This type of aggressive bundled promotion reflects a common retail strategy in Hong Kong, particularly around peak shopping seasons. By offering household goods with high utility and perceived value—often exceeding the cost of the qualifying purchase itself—retailers effectively shift high volumes of inventory and drive customer loyalty. For consumers, it presents an opportunity to address several domestic needs simultaneously, acquiring oral care essentials alongside kitchen upgrades and cleaning supplies at zero additional cost.
